Alpaca Palace wrote: LAAF Paladin's Belledin is one of the first Paladin east coast progeny--and also one of his best. Thank you Mike and Sarah for offering one of your finest foundation females for us to add to enhance our breeding program. Belledin is white but carries alot of color in her background. Perfect conformation, medium bone and sturdy frame. Great coverage, with incredible crimp well into her lower legs. Her crimp is very consistent and is evident without even opening her fleece, extending to the very tip of the fiber. Belledin is very dense. She has taken Reserve Champion twice and in the shows where she placed fourth, both times the judges remarked that any of the top four could have been in first. Belledin's dam, LA Belleza placed at the top of her classes in very competitive Level V shows has maintained one of our best fleeces out of Long Acre Alpaca Farm's foundation females. Belledin's sire, Paladin, is an impressive male with a fantastic genetic background. Paladin has one of the densest fleeces and his crimp curvature is possibly one of several highest ever recorded by fiber analysis.
